Finding Commercial Upgrade Financing: Alternatives & Criteria
Embarking on a commercial renovation project? Finding the right financing can feel complex. Several choices exist, each with distinct criteria. Standard bank financing often require solid financial history and significant equity, while Small Business Administration (SBA) credit may offer more favorable rates and lower down advances. Non-traditional providers like online platforms and local institutions can also be viable avenues , particularly for businesses with limited history. Typically , you'll need to provide a detailed project plan, including cost forecasts, revenue statements, and records of the intended work. Carefully evaluate your circumstances and contrast different bids to secure the most advantageous funding for your business .

Office Renovation Expense Breakdown: Grasping the Elements
Determining the total price of a business renovation can be difficult due to several factors . Major portions of the budget are often allocated to labor , which generally comprises between 30% to 50%, depending on the scope of the undertaking . Supplies , like surfaces, lighting , and ventilation systems, usually account for 20% to 40%, Commercial construction cost per square foot 2024 fluctuating based on material decisions and quality . Design costs can range from 5% to 15%, and legal fees contribute approximately 2% to 5%. Contingency costs , often set aside at 5% to 10%, are vital to manage unforeseen problems during the refurbishment process. Ultimately, the area of the property and local construction rates will significantly impact the work’s overall cost .
